广告广告
  加入我的最爱 设为首页 风格修改
首页 首尾
 手机版   订阅   地图  繁体 
您是第 2746 个阅读者
 
发表文章 发表投票 回覆文章
  可列印版   加为IE收藏   收藏主题   上一主题 | 下一主题   
文心 手机
数位造型
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x0 鲜花 x8
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片
推文 x0
[Java] JAVA~~~拜托帮帮忙
题目是: 设计一个含有length及width属性的rectangle类别, 而且这两种属性预设值是1.该类别具有可计算矩形的perimeter(周长)及area(面积)的方法.当然也必须提供length和width的set及get方法. set方法应该要能够检查length及width都是否为浮点数. 且其值会大于0.0而小于20.0.


请帮我把???部份写出来好吗 谢谢


class Rectangle
{
in ..

访客只能看到部份内容,免费 加入会员 或由脸书 Google 可以看到全部内容




终于上大学了~~感觉好特别唷
献花 x0 回到顶端 [楼 主] From:台湾 和信超媒体宽带网 | Posted:2006-06-02 01:08 |
奉茶
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x0 鲜花 x21
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

class rectangle{
private double length = 1;
private double width = 1;
private String str = null;
public rectangle(double l,double w,String s){
length = l; width = w; str = s;
}
public double Length(){
return length;
}
public double Width(){
return width;
}
public setLength(double length){
if(length > 0.0 && length < 20.0)
this.length = length;
}
public setWidth(double width){
if(width > 0.0 && width < 20.0)
this.width = width;
}
public String Print(){
return width + str + "x" + height + str;
}
public String Perimeter(){
return ((length+width)*2) + str;
}
public String Area(){
return (length * width) + "平方" + str;
}
}


献花 x0 回到顶端 [1 楼] From:台湾和信超媒体 | Posted:2006-06-02 13:07 |
文心 手机
数位造型
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x0 鲜花 x8
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

谢谢你的回答唷~~~
不过可不可以问一下这个是要放在我上面题目的问号里面吗



终于上大学了~~感觉好特别唷
献花 x0 回到顶端 [2 楼] From:台湾 和信超媒体宽带网 | Posted:2006-06-05 15:08 |
奉茶
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x0 鲜花 x21
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

这是给你参考的
你要自己稍微修改一下^^


献花 x0 回到顶端 [3 楼] From:台湾和信超媒体 | Posted:2006-06-06 12:51 |
文心 手机
数位造型
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x0 鲜花 x8
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

OK了解~~~感谢你的顶力相助



终于上大学了~~感觉好特别唷
献花 x0 回到顶端 [4 楼] From:印度尼西亚 | Posted:2006-06-06 16:44 |
文心 手机
数位造型
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x0 鲜花 x8
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

class Rectangle
{
double length,width; //长,宽
String unit;     //单位
private double length = 1;
private double width = 1;
private String unit = null;
{
     public rectangle (double l,double w,String u);
}

{
length = l;
width = w;
unit = u;

}

public double Length()
{
return length;
}
public double Width()
{
return width;
}
public void length(double length);
{
if(length > 0.0 && length < 20.0)
this.length = length;
}
public void width(double width);
{
if(width > 0.0 && width < 20.0)
this.width = width;
}



public String Print()
{
System.out.print("\n");
return("长方形:"+length+unit+"*"+width+unit);

}
public String Area()
{
System.out.print("\n");
return("长方形面积:"+(width*length)+"平方"+unit);

}
public String Length()
{
System.out.print("\n");
return("长方形周长:"+(length+width)*2+unit);

}

}

class rectangle1
{

public static void main(String args[])
  {
       Rectangle r1=new Rectangle(12,10,"公分");
        r1.Print(); // 长方形:12公分x10公分
        r1.Area();   // 长方形面积:120 平方公分
        r1.Length(); // 长方形周长:44 公分
       Rectangle r2=new Rectangle(5,6,"公尺");        
        r2.Print(); // 长方形:5公尺x6公尺
        r2.Area();   // 长方形面积:30 平方公尺
        r2.Length(); // 长方形周长:22 公尺        
  }      
  }

/*
长方形:12公分x10公分
长方形面积:120 平方公分
长方形周长:44 公分
长方形:5公尺x6公尺
长方形面积:30 平方公尺
长方形周长:22 公尺  
press any key to continue...
     
*/



终于上大学了~~感觉好特别唷
献花 x0 回到顶端 [5 楼] From:印度尼西亚 | Posted:2006-06-06 17:20 |
文心 手机
数位造型
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x0 鲜花 x8
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

那可以请问一下我这样有那里错了吗~~~拜托了~~~ 表情



终于上大学了~~感觉好特别唷
献花 x0 回到顶端 [6 楼] From:印度尼西亚 | Posted:2006-06-06 17:20 |
奉茶
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x0 鲜花 x21
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

帮你改好了^^"
原来我之前也犯了一些错误

class InvalidRangeException extends Exception{}
class Rectangle
{
private double length = 1,width = 1; //长,宽
String unit = null;   //单位
public Rectangle (double l,double w,String u){
length = l;
width = w;
unit = u;

}

public double Length()
{
return length;
}
public double Width()
{
return width;
}
public void length(double length) throws InvalidRangeException
{
if(length > 0.0 && length < 20.0)
this.length = length;
else
throw new InvalidRangeException();
}
public void width(double width) throws InvalidRangeException
{
if(width > 0.0 && width < 20.0)
this.width = width;
else
throw new InvalidRangeException();
}



public void Print()
{
System.out.println();
System.out.println("长方形:"+length+unit+"*"+width+unit);

}
public void Area()
{
System.out.println();
System.out.println("长方形面积:"+(width*length)+"平方"+unit);

}
public void perimeter()
{
System.out.println();
System.out.println("长方形周长:"+(length+width)*2+unit);

}

}

class rectangle1
{

public static void main(String args[])
{
    Rectangle r1=new Rectangle(12,10,"公分");
    r1.Print(); // 长方形:12公分x10公分
    r1.Area();   // 长方形面积:120 平方公分
    r1.perimeter(); // 长方形周长:44 公分
    Rectangle r2=new Rectangle(5,6,"公尺");      
    r2.Print(); // 长方形:5公尺x6公尺
    r2.Area();   // 长方形面积:30 平方公尺
    r2.perimeter(); // 长方形周长:22 公尺      
}    
}
自己compile看看
我就是没有自己compile才会没注意到有错误^^"


[ 此文章被奉茶在2006-06-07 08:28重新编辑 ]

此文章被评分,最近评分记录
财富:20 (by codeboy) | 理由: 热心助人...感谢您的回覆喔..^^


献花 x1 回到顶端 [7 楼] From:台湾和信超媒体 | Posted:2006-06-07 07:51 |
文心 手机
数位造型
个人文章 个人相簿 个人日记 个人地图
小人物
级别: 小人物 该用户目前不上站
推文 x0 鲜花 x8
分享: 转寄此文章 Facebook Plurk Twitter 复制连结到剪贴簿 转换为繁体 转换为简体 载入图片

因为你的顶力帮助~~~~我的java才不致于当掉~~~~谢谢 表情



终于上大学了~~感觉好特别唷
献花 x0 回到顶端 [8 楼] From:印度尼西亚 | Posted:2006-06-07 13:40 |

首页  发表文章 发表投票 回覆文章
Powered by PHPWind v1.3.6
Copyright © 2003-04 PHPWind
Processed in 0.016784 second(s),query:16 Gzip disabled
本站由 瀛睿律师事务所 担任常年法律顾问 | 免责声明 | 本网站已依台湾网站内容分级规定处理 | 连络我们 | 访客留言